Linux下数据库搭建与深度学习任务稳定运行指南
|
在Linux环境下搭建数据库,需先确认系统已安装必要的依赖包。使用apt-get或yum命令更新软件源,随后安装MySQL或PostgreSQL。以MySQL为例,可通过sudo apt install mysql-server完成安装,安装完成后运行sudo systemctl enable mysql启动服务,并通过sudo mysql_secure_installation设置root密码与安全选项。 配置数据库时,建议修改默认端口并限制远程访问权限,提升安全性。编辑配置文件如/etc/mysql/mysql.conf.d/mysqld.cnf,设置bind-address为127.0.0.1,仅允许本地连接。创建专用用户并分配最小必要权限,避免使用root账户执行日常操作。 深度学习任务对计算资源要求较高,需确保系统配备高性能GPU及足够的内存。安装NVIDIA驱动和CUDA工具包是关键步骤。通过nvidia-smi验证驱动是否正常加载,再安装对应版本的cuDNN库,以加速模型训练过程。 使用Python虚拟环境管理依赖,推荐使用conda或pipenv。安装PyTorch、TensorFlow等主流框架时,应选择与CUDA版本兼容的发行包。例如,使用conda install pytorch torchvision torchaudio cudatoolkit=11.8 -c pytorch安装支持CUDA 11.8的PyTorch。 为保障任务长期稳定运行,建议使用systemd服务或supervisor管理后台进程。编写服务配置文件,设定自动重启策略,防止因异常退出导致任务中断。同时,定期备份数据库与模型权重,可借助rsync或cron定时同步至远程存储。 监控系统资源使用情况至关重要。安装htop、nmon或使用Grafana+Prometheus组合,实时查看CPU、GPU、内存与磁盘负载。当发现资源瓶颈时,及时调整任务调度或升级硬件。
2026AI模拟图,仅供参考 保持系统与软件持续更新,定期应用安全补丁。关注官方公告,及时升级数据库与深度学习框架版本,避免已知漏洞带来的风险。良好的运维习惯是实现高可用与高效能的核心保障。(编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

